National Women’s Hockey League secures TV deal with New England Sports Network

The National Women’s Hockey League (NWHL), the first women’s hockey league in North America to pay its players, has secured a TV deal that will see eight Boston Pride games air on the New England Sports Network (NESN), marking the first TV deal for the start-up league which is in its first season of operation.

“This is a great opportunity for women’s hockey to reach the four million viewers in NESN’s coverage area,” said NWHL Commissioner Dani Rylan. “The broadcast value of the women’s game has never been better, and we’re happy NESN is providing a stage for and shining a spotlight on some of the best players in the world.”

The first televised game will come on Sunday, November 22 when the Boston Pride host the New York Riveters. The game will begin at 3 p.m. EST.

“We are excited to become the first television partner of the NWHL during its inaugural season,” said Joseph Maar, NESN’s Vice President of Programming & Production. “Some of the best women hockey players in the world will play on NESN this winter. We hope fans will catch this new league on Sunday afternoons.”

Here is the full TV schedule of games on NESN:

Sun. November 22nd vs. New York Riveters 3PM (ET) – NESN
Sun. November 29th vs. Connecticut Whale 3PM (ET) – NESN
Sun. December 6th vs. New York Riveters 3:30PM (ET) – NESN
Sun. December 20th vs. Buffalo Beauts 3PM (ET) – NESNplus
Sun. January 3rd vs. Buffalo Beauts 3PM (ET) – NESNplus
Sun. January 10th vs. New York Riveters 3PM (ET) – NESNplus
Sun. January 17th vs. Connecticut Whale 3PM (ET) – NESN
Sun. February 14th vs. Connecticut Whale 3PM (ET) – NESNplus
